What heritage sites are located in Albion Park Rail?

The suburb includes a heritage‑listed Albion Park railway station on the Princes Highway, reflecting the area’s historic link to the South Coast rail line opened in 1887.

What is the climate like in Albion Park Rail?

Albion Park Rail experiences a humid subtropical climate bordering on oceanic, with warm, wetter summers and mild, drier winters. Extreme recorded temperatures have ranged from 45.8 °C in summer to –2.0 °C in winter.
